Ah, the Empire. Student stalwart with lots of live entertainment -- I've seen more acts than I could list here and their live production team does not let you down. Second to none in terms of sheer beauty (apologies to the Crown), this pub is well worth an evening. Music sounds great and lush in this historic church building, and there's hardly a bad seat in the house. One star off for their limited drink selection -- just a couple bottles of craft IPAs or sours would do it for us snobs! But I can't criticize them too harshly -- they cater best to their market, which is primarily the cheap and cheerful student crowd.
